2002 Acura NSX vs. 1958 Cadillac Eldorado

To start off, 2002 Acura NSX is newer by 44 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1958 Cadillac Eldorado.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1958 Cadillac Eldorado would be higher. At 5,980 cc (8 cylinders), 1958 Cadillac Eldorado is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2002 Acura NSX (249 HP @ 6600 RPM) has 45 more horse power than 1958 Cadillac Eldorado. (204 HP @ 4700 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2002 Acura NSX should accelerate faster than 1958 Cadillac Eldorado.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1958 Cadillac Eldorado weights approximately 760 kg more than 2002 Acura NSX.

Both vehicles are rear wheel drive (RWD) - it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, both vehicles do the job better than front wheel drive vehicles. Compare all specifications:

2002 Acura NSX 1958 Cadillac Eldorado
Make Acura Cadillac
Model NSX Eldorado
Year Released 2002 1958
Body Type Coupe Coupe
Engine Position Middle Front
Engine Size 2977 cc 5980 cc
Engine Cylinders 6 cylinders 8 cylinders
Engine Type V V
Valves per Cylinder 4 valves 2 valves
Horse Power 249 HP 204 HP
Engine RPM 6600 RPM 4700 RPM
Fuel Type Gasoline Gasoline
Drive Type Rear Rear
Number of Seats 2 seats 5 seats
Number of Doors 2 doors 2 doors
Vehicle Weight 1430 kg 2190 kg
Vehicle Length 4430 mm 5650 mm
Vehicle Width 1820 mm 2030 mm
Wheelbase Size 2540 mm 3300 mm
